Karaganda State Technical University (KSTU) is a public university located in Karaganda, Kazakhstan. KSTU is one of the oldest universities in the country and is highly ranked among universities in Kazakhstan.

KSTU offers a wide range of programs for students to study, including bachelor's, master's, and doctoral degrees. It has more than 20 departments and faculties, including engineering, economics, and law. The university also offers a variety of scholarship opportunities for international students.

The acceptance rate of KSTU is quite high, and the requirements for admission are not too strict. Applicants must submit a completed application form, transcripts, and other documents. The cost of tuition varies depending on the program and the number of credits taken.

KSTU also offers accommodation for students, including dormitories, apartments, and hostels. The university has a range of fees for accommodation, and students should check with the university for more details.
